Boston Globe:

The only big blow for the Celtics came in the final minutes, when Kevin Garnett jumped to block a shot by Vince Carter, landing awkwardly and tumbling to the ground. He hobbled back to the bench holding his back and didn't return.

Celtics coach Doc Rivers said Garnett mostly had a bruise on his head. Garnett said he was fine.

"If he grew some hair, it wouldn't hurt so much," Rivers joked.
